Finding the perfect toys for 8 year olds may pose a unique challenge because this is the age when kids are developing unique hobbies and behaviors. Some of them may be interested in ingenious and creative toys, while others may have evolved interests ranging from STEM, arts, or music. 8 years olds frequently go through a growing up process. They start to develop their personalities and experiment with their independence. Therefore, they must have access to toys that accurately reflect their individuality.
Roseann Capanna-Hodge, a school psychologist and pediatric mental health expert has observed that “the toys that 8-year-olds choose reflect a desire for structured and hierarchal independence.” Similarly, such toys should align with the likes and dislikes of kids fostering both enjoyment and curiosity to explore and learn.

1. LEGO Technic Cherry Picker Building Blocks
Source: https://m.media-amazon.com/images/I/71Yxz8K-QTL._SL1024_.jpg
This Lego set is crafted to offer a building experience that is both rewarding and immersive. It provides an excellent overview of the building industry. It features a detailed lifting mechanism with a working boom and basket, brick-built warning lights, and beacons and wheels with chunky tires. Children are able to operate the boom, steer the Cherry Picker, and lift the basket high. This is one of the toys for 8-year-olds through which they can understand the basics of gears, force, and movement.

2. Chalk and Chuckles Scavenger Hunt
Source: https://m.media-amazon.com/images/I/71jegPk3MgL._SL1500_.jpg
A classic game of Search and Find with a simple twist to connect it with STEM concepts. Rotate the spinner and remove a stick matching its colour . Compete to locate the item that best matches the description first. Play it either indoors or outdoors—after all, science is present everywhere. Because heat-sensitive ink is used in its printing, an answer will become visible when you rub it. Your youngsters will develop a lifelong enthusiasm for science after playing this game.

5. Make Indian Art Forms DIY Set
Source: https://cdn.fcglcdn.com/brainbees/images/products/438×531/12606990a.webp
India as a country is vast, diverse, and home to many ethnic tribes which have many different folk art forms. Five traditional art forms, from Madhubani in the east to Warli in the west, are included in this do-it-yourself craft package for exploration and education. Using inventive approaches, children can learn how to create several ancient art forms, such as Bagru block printing using stamps, Mandala stickers, Lippan on canvas, and Madhubani cloth.

9. Pictureka Board Game
The Pictureka board game is laugh-out-loud fun for family and friends as players try to find it fast and first! Players compete to locate the nine game tiles—filled with wacky images—as instructed by their mission cards. They get to prevent the mission card if they locate the correct object. The person who has the most cards wins at the end!
